Elisabeth Rosenthal, Harvard-trained medical doctor, former healthcare reporter for The New York Times, and current editor-in-chief of Kaiser Health News, discusses her book An American Sickness: How Healthcare Became Big Business and How You Can Take it Back. Rosenthal explains how the healthcare industry prioritizes profits over patient health, and she outlines steps for taking more control over your healthcare budget.
